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
818928 2131 223668 2055303388
26106711688 890247
26106711688 890247
479277606 7884132 618 4992237087
All about undefined
Interested in learning more?
26106711688 890247
479277606 7884132 618 4992237087
See more
8766 83755 2462876733
0766633560 766 69363 24
See more
965 18341 07410363
540341 205 19432
See more